Bully Tools ™ Super Fork

Takes on heavy, rocky soils without bending

  • All-steel construction
  • Tines won’t bend or break in tough soils
  • USA made

The heavy-duty Bully Tools ™ Super Fork handles any spading job you put beneath it. All-steel construction and an 11"L x 7"W head with 1/2"-dia. tines won’t bend or break in tough soils like lightweight spading forks. Handle is 35"L with a large, 8"W D-grip so you can use both hands, even while wearing gloves. Overall length 46-1/2". Weighs 8.75 lbs. USA made.

    Comments about Bully Tools Super Fork:

    The sturdy tool is excellent for breaking up heavy clay soil. Everything else I tried bent. This baby works.

    Comments about Bully Tools Super Fork:

    The first Super Fork I ordered (from another supplier) came with a bent handle. The replacement I bought from Gempler's arrived in good shape but I bent a tine on the first use. If Bully Tools switched to a better quality of steel then the fork might truly be worthy of its name.

    The footstep is a good feature.

    It's not a bad offering for its price class but I was expecting a "Super Fork" and didn't get one.

    Comments about Bully Tools Super Fork:

    Great: Solid construction, stands up to a beating (I have an orchard and there are some rocky/rough spots that this tool is not afraid of)

    Not so great: The shipment packing style left the tines exposed to bending enroute - one of the outer tines was bent in by about 10 degrees. The flanges on either end of the welded handle are very uncomfortable to work with - I ended up grinding them down to make my hands happy. And I'd like a little wider foot landing zone at the top of the tine field - even another inch would be excellent.
